DP Tuners!

Well, I just wanted to say that I recieved my DP Tuner for my 2001 F350 6spd 7.3L Pickup. And all I can say is WOW! I have the Smoke as stage 1 and its fun to play with, but not really driveable. Then I have the 60horse tow tune that pretty much blows my old SuperChips tuner completely out of the water. Then I have my 80horse economy tune that is that much more impressive. Following that is the 120horse and the 140horse add, and well.... They are just stupid to try to drive with a stick shift!

Originally Posted by jhand124
Is Diane saying that all chips come with 0 as no start, or is 0 just redundant stock setting?
Sorry, let me clarify....

All of the F5 chips come with position 0. No-start is one of the program options for position 0. Some put stock. Others have put the valet setting in position 0.
